Transformations of epoxide derived from NOPOL (cas 128-50-7) in the presence of natural askanite-bentonite clay were studied. The major products of the isomerization in the cold are diols possessing a p-menthane skeleton, which are readily converted into bicyclic ethers when the reaction is carried out at room temperature.
